Forum Asset Management – Manager, Accounting

Location: On-site, Toronto

Work Schedule: Full-time, in-office/on-site (5 days/week)

About Forum Delivering Extraordinary Outcomes through Investment.

Forum Asset Management is a North American investor, developer, and asset manager with a 28-year track record of delivering long-term value through real estate, private equity, and infrastructure investments. We are a purpose-driven firm committed to sustainability, responsible investing, and making a positive impact in the communities where we invest.

With over $3 billion in AUM, Forum is one of Canada's most dynamic investment platforms. In 2024, we completed the country's largest real estate transaction through our acquisition of Alignvest Student Housing, making us the largest owner and developer of Purpose-Built Student Accommodation (PBSA) in Canada. Our open-ended Real Estate Income and Impact Fund (REIIF) is now over $2.4 billion, backed by a $3.5 billion development pipeline that spans coast to coast.

Position Overview The Accounting Manager will manage the Senior Accountant and AP Coordinator and report into the Director. This candidate will take ownership over the corporate accounting and reporting functions. To be successful in this position, the candidate must have strong accounting and analytical skills, be highly insightful, respectful of deadlines, detail‐oriented, and have a demonstrated ability to effectively prioritize workflow. The Accounting Manager works well in a team environment, is keen to learn, and thrives in an entrepreneurial environment where the role is not routine.

Key Responsibilities

  • Preparation of monthly financial package for internal stakeholders, including financial statements, investment reports, and analysis of financial information.
  • Responsible for reviewing and completing full cycle accounting duties, including bank reconciliations, posting journal entries, accruals, and intercompany transactions.
  • Manage the corporate budget process. Including analyzes of actual vs budget for Company overhead and providing insights on variances for management decision making.
  • Responsible for mentoring Senior Accountant and reviewing work such as HST filings, bank reconciliations, credit card reconciliations, employee expense coding, and AP processing.
  • Oversight of liquidity processes. Including weekly liquidity reports, managing monthly cash forecasts, working with Real Estate and Private Equity teams to ensure accuracy and completeness.
  • Manage annual audit process, responding to auditor inquiries, preparing relevant working papers, and ensuring appropriate accounting treatment under ASPE.
  • Participate in process improvement initiatives, including automation and system implementation.
  • Prepare and review legal entity financial statements for compliance and tax reporting purposes

Candidate Profile

  • Bachelor's Degree required in Accounting or Finance
  • Completion or in final stages of CPA designation
  • Minimum of 4‐5 years of related experience required
  • Strong full cycle General Accounting Experience/knowledge
  • Proficiency with Accounting Software QuickBooks and/or Yardi
  • Knowledge of IFRS and/or ASPE is an asset
  • Excellent verbal and written communication and interpersonal skills
  • Ability to handle multiple tasks simultaneously in a high‐growth, fast‐paced environment
  • Possesses a style of strong teamwork, collaboration, flexibility, and strength in being proactive
  • "Roll‐up the sleeves" approach to accomplish all necessary tasks
  • Commitment to excellence and impeccable ethical standards and integrity
